Accounting | CRACKER for CA Foundation Paper 1 is a comprehensive guide bridging the conceptual clarity gap and practical problem-solving. Tailored to align with the strict ICAI syllabus for the CA Foundation, this book compiles previous examination questions (including the May 2025 exam), relevant RTPs (Revision Test Papers), MTPs (Mock Test Papers), and additional practice questions—making it a one-stop solution for exam preparation.
The Present Publication is the 14th Edition for the Sept. 2025/ Jan. 2026 Exams. This book is authored by Dr S.K. Agrawal & CA. Manmeet Kaur, with the following noteworthy features:
[Complete Past Exam Coverage] Includes questions asked in CA Foundation exams up to May 2025, ensuring readers are well-versed with the latest trends in exam patterns
[Additional Important Questions] Offers supplementary practice questions that reinforce critical concepts and address potential exam topics that might appear in upcoming papers
[RTPs/MTPs] Incorporates questions from Revision Test Papers and Mock Test Papers released by ICAI, allowing students to get familiar with ICAI's expected answering style
[Uniquely Designed Marks Distribution Chart] Presents a chapter-wise weightage of past examinations, giving a clear picture of high-importance areas
[Chapter-Wise Mapping] Each chapter is systematically correlated with the ICAI Study Material for streamlined study and revision
[Comprehensive Question Coverage] Encompasses theoretical questions, illustrations, short notes, and True/False questions to cater to every requirement of the CA Foundation – Paper 1
[Focused on Conceptual Clarity & Quick Revision] As a 'CRACKER’-style resource, this book emphasises clarity and brevity, making it perfect for last-minute revisions without compromising on conceptual depth
[Holistic Study Approach] Encourages thorough reading of ICAI modules in conjunction with this book, emphasising conceptual clarity, regular writing practice, and disciplined preparation
The coverage of the book is as follows:
Conceptual Foundation
Explains the fundamentals of accounting—meaning, scope, principles, concepts, and conventions
Standards & Policies
Dives into the nuances of Accounting Standards, Accounting Policies, and Valuation Principles
Detailed Practical Topics
Includes comprehensive coverage of Journal, Ledger, Trial Balance, Subsidiary Books, Bank Reconciliation Statement, Rectification of Errors, Depreciation, Inventory Valuation, Final Accounts, Partnership Accounting, etc.
Corporate Accounting Areas
Newly introduced chapters such as Accounting from Incomplete Records, Shares, Debentures, Financial Statements of Companies, Accounting for Bonus Issue & Right Issue, Redemption of Preference Shares, and Redemption of Debentures reflect the updated ICAI syllabus
Exam-focused Compilation
Each chapter integrates past exam questions, relevant practice sets, and additional illustrations so students can thoroughly test their understanding
